Output aabbcc587590c208b77b1e2fd0292d9a02ea4ee1fb8d195f4ca1663af656139a:0

value
32284
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 366f3b4b153b600899f79cc1e20a60155b142de6df44a47e190e59f7002d029a
address
bc1pxehnkjc48dsq3x0hnnq7yznqz4d3gt0xmaz2glsepevlwqpdq2dq03xagt
transaction
aabbcc587590c208b77b1e2fd0292d9a02ea4ee1fb8d195f4ca1663af656139a
confirmations
108035
spent
true